    amcnow wrote: »
    October 26th - Received email confirming submission of endorsement application. Was told to allow 6 weeks for processing.
    November 9th - Received first email stating request is still being processed.
    November 23rd - Received second email stating request is still being processed. Was told to allow the full 6 weeks for processing.

    December 7th - End of 6 week waiting period. No official word.
    December 8th (12:27am EST) - Me: "What's taking so long?" icon_sad.gif
    December 8th (9:22am EST) - ISC2: "Congratulations! It gives me great pleasure to be the first to address you with the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P[FONT=&quot][FONT=&quot][FONT=&quot]®[/FONT][/FONT][/FONT]) designation![FONT=&quot][FONT=&quot][FONT=&quot][/FONT][FONT=&quot][/FONT][/FONT][/FONT]" icon_thumright.gif
